Cairo Chamber of Commerce launches summer clothing discounts up to 40% in Egypt

The Cairo Chamber of Commerce’s ready‑made clothing committee announced participation in the government‑mandated summer “occasions” sale starting 3 August 2026. Discounts will range from 10 % to more than 40 % on a wide array of garments. The initiative follows Minister of Supply and Internal Trade Dr. Sherif Farouk’s decree No. 142/2026, which authorises a month‑long seasonal clearance, limiting each participating store’s sale period to two weeks and requiring prior approval and clear price labeling to protect consumer rights.

Chamber president Ayman Al‑Ashri directed the committee, led by Khaled Faid, to coordinate with traders to ensure broad participation. The timing coincides with families preparing for the new school year, and the Chamber highlighted the social and economic benefits of the sale – boosting purchasing power, stimulating market activity, and maintaining price stability while complying with consumer‑protection regulations.
